Transaction ae8c496265fe24d7c0d4203561c6a3a1e8419d1ca42cc5102685fc687e2118f9
1 Input
1 Output
-
ae8c496265fe24d7c0d4203561c6a3a1e8419d1ca42cc5102685fc687e2118f9:0
- value
- 2528644
- script pubkey
- OP_0 OP_PUSHBYTES_20 31b6e4d371c04588caac9cd676147dbc8778a430
- address
- bc1qxxmwf5m3cpzc3j4vnnt8v9rahjrh3fps3wkksy